About this trial
Respiratory syncytial virus (RSV) is the most common respiratory infectious pathogen recognized worldwide that poses serious health risks to infants, and an important cause of hospitalization for severe respiratory infections in infants. Serious respiratory problems such as pneumonia caused by RSV are one of the leading causes of death from respiratory diseases in infants. AK0529 targets the Pre-F (fusion) protein on the surface of the viral envelope. Specifically, it prevents the virus from invading uninfected cells and inhibits the fusion between host cells by inhibiting the fusion of the F (fusion) proteins on the surface of the RSV envelope, thus providing the effects of anti-RSV infection. This is a randomized, double-blind, placebo-controlled, multicenter, phase III clinical study to evaluate the efficacy and safety of AK0529 in hospitalized infants aged 1 to 24 months with RSV infection. Considering the benefits of AK0529 in the population with RSV infection, hospitalized infants with moderate to severe RSV infection were selected as the target population for this study.
Eligibility criteria
Qualifiers
Male or female subjects of any ethnicity with an age adjusted for any prematurity of ≥1 month and ≤24 months.
Diagnosis of RSV infection by any virological means, including a rapid diagnostic point-of-care testing, within 36 hours preceding initial dosing.
The onset of RSV infection symptoms should be ≤ 5 days prior to initial dosing.
Subject must weigh ≥ 2.5 kg and ≤ 20 kg at screening and be within the normal range for the subject's age, based on local child growth standards.
Disqualifiers
The subject has taken any restricted medications within 3 days prior to the date of screening or requires any restricted medications during treatment phase (including interferons, ribavirin, or proprietary Chinese medicines with antiviral effects) and has taken any inhaled or systemic glucocorticoids within 24 hours.
Subject is known to have co-infection with influenza virus, Mycoplasma, or other respiratory tract pathogens that require targeted clinical treatment .
Subject is known to have bacterial pneumonia.
Subject with clinical evidence of hepatic decompensation (e.g., liver disease with coagulation abnormalities or encephalopathy).
